Learn moreThe Cliff Top Walk takes walkers on a return trail from Point D'Entrecasteaux to Tookulup. A winding route away from the car park allows visitors to experience uninterrupted views of the sheer cliffs and limestone drops into the vast Southern Ocean. Several information boards are in place detailing the heritage of D'Entrecasteaux National Park and surrounding areas rich with Bibbulman and Minang people historical sites.

D’Entrecasteaux National Park is a remote area and visitors should come prepared.
Coastal risks include king waves, tidal surges and cliff collapses. Lives have been lost along this coast so please take care in and around the water.
Mobile phone communication in the park is generally poor and should not be relied upon. Be aware that you need mobile coverage to contact emergency services on 000. Ensure you monitor mobile phone signal while in the park and seek high points in the landscape to aid communication.
